Ḥasdaï ben Salomon est un rabbin espagnol probablement né à Tudèle, disciple de R. Nissim Gerondi à Barcelone, que son ami Isaac ben Sheshet appelait le « digne d'Espagne ». Rabbin jusqu'en 1379, année où la peste éclate à Tudèle, il part alors, toujours célibataire, exercer à Valence. Correspondant de Ḥasdaï Crescas et d'Isaac ben Sheshet, il s'oppose par piété rigoureuse aux innovations rituelles introduites par Ḥayyim Galipapa de Pampelune.
